Shrimp and Sausage Foil Packet Dinner

  • Total Time: 35-40 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ined (use fresh or thawed frozen shrimp)
  • 1/2 lb smoked sausage, sliced (andouille or kielbasa works well)
  • 2 ears of corn, cut into 4 pieces each (fresh or frozen)
  • 1 lb baby red potatoes, halved or quartered (for even cooking)
  • 2 tbsp olive oil (helps coat and crisp the ingredients)
  • 2 tsp Cajun or Creole seasoning (adjust to your spice preference)
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ced (for aromatic flavor)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Lemon wedges and fresh parsley (for garnish and brightness)

Instructions

  • Preheat: Preheat your grill to medium-high heat or your oven to 425°F (220°C).
  • Prepare the Ingredients: In a large bowl, combine the shrimp, sausage, corn, and potatoes.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with Cajun seasoning, minced garlic, salt, and pepper. Toss until everything is evenly coated.
  • Assemble the Packets: Divide the mixture among four large sheets of heavy-duty aluminum foil. Fold the edges to seal the packets tightly, leaving a little room for steam to circulate.
  • Cook:
    • Grill: Place the packets on the grill and cook for 10-12 minutes, flipping halfway through.
    • Oven: Place the packets on a baking sheet and bake for 20-25 minutes.
  • Check for Doneness: The shrimp should be pink and opaque, and the potatoes should be tender when pierced with a fork.
  • Serve: Carefully open the packets (watch for steam) and garnish with lemon wedges and fresh parsley. Serve immediately.

Notes

  • For a gluten-free version, ensure the Cajun seasoning and sausage are gluten-free.
